Brand
Brands play an important role in determining the price of power tools, as well as the features they offer. Pro-grade power tools can cost three or four times more than DIY models and have a one-year guarantee (or service agreements). The top brands are focused on a specific niche within the market (metalworkers are a fan of Milwaukee and carpenters prefer DeWalt) and others provide an array of tools for homeowners, such as Ryobi and Black & Decker; and still other power tool manufacturers specialize in commercial or industrial applications, like Metabo. Certain battery-powered power tool interfaces aren't compatible between manufacturers (even in the same product line) this can result in vendor lock-in. However, there are aftermarket adapters available that allow you use batteries from different brands with their tools.

The Right to Rent
A good warranty on power tools can give you peace of mind. Most manufacturers offer a guarantee of some sort, but only a handful are truly committed to their customers. Ridgid goes above and beyond industry standards with its Lifetime Service Agreement. This means that the original owner of a Ridgid tool will never need to pay for repairs or replacement, regardless of the time it happens. This is an enormous benefit for smaller companies who rely on their tools to stay efficient.
The warranty period of a power tool is also important. The warranty period for top-quality tools is usually longer, whereas the warranty period for less expensive ones may be shorter. Even mid-range tools can last a long while with regular maintenance and use.
When choosing a power tool, choose one with a guarantee that is appropriate for the type of work you're doing. If you are a homeowner, you might need a shorter warranty than if you are a contractor. The warranty should be simple and easy to comprehend, with a phone number or online system that yields quick responses when you have a problem.
Milwaukee For instance, Milwaukee offers a limited warranty of five years which covers workmanship and materials. However, it does not cover normal wear and tear and alterations, misuse or neglect, as well as the lack of maintenance. The warranty does not cover battery packs, chargers or knives and bits.
